Frequently Asked Questions

What is required before digging fence post holes?

You must contact Montana 811 at least three business days before excavation. They will mark all public underground utilities. Hitting a gas, water, or fiber line in Helena Valley West Central is a major financial and safety liability. A professional crew manages this call and pulls any necessary permit from the Lewis and Clark County permit office.

How do you build a fence to handle 105 MPH winds?

The 105 MPH V-ult wind speed is an ultimate design load per ASCE 7-22 standards. This engineering requirement dictates tighter post spacing (often 6 feet on-center or less), deeper concrete footings, and the use of heavy-duty post brackets and fasteners. This design is critical to survive peak storm season gusts off the Continental Divide.

Why must my fence posts be set below 48 inches?

Helena Valley West Central has a 48-inch frost line. IRC Section R403.1.4 mandates footings be set below this depth. If posts are shallower, frost heave from freeze-thaw cycles will push them up, causing the fence to fail. This is a primary cause of structural failure in our neighborhood.

What fence materials work best here?

With moderate soil corrosivity and slight termite risk, material compatibility is key. Use pressure-treated wood rated for ground contact or vinyl. For metal posts and hardware, specify hot-dip galvanized steel or aluminum to prevent rust streaks. Avoid plain steel fasteners which will corrode.

What are the height and placement rules for my fence?

Zoning in Helena Valley West Central limits fences to 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ear yards, with a 0-foot setback allowing construction on the property line. Critical for corner lots: you must maintain a clear 'sight triangle' at intersections for driver visibility, especially near high-speed corridors like I-15.

Can I add a smart gate to my pool fence?

Yes. Integrating a smart, self-closing IoT gate latch with access logs can enhance security and help meet liability standards. The primary barrier must still comply with IBC/IRC Appendix AG, requiring a 54-inch non-climbable barrier with self-latching hardware. This tech trend is growing in Montana for modern risk management.

What are my legal duties before replacing a shared boundary fence?

Montana Code Annotated 70-16-205, the 'Good Neighbor Fence Law,' requires you to provide written notice to the adjoining landowner before building or replacing a partition fence. As of 2026, this notification is a strict legal prerequisite in Helena. Failure to comply can result in liability for damages.
